    No, a Japan visit visa is meant strictly for tourism purposes. It cannot be directly converted into a work visa. If you plan to work in Japan, you must apply separately for an approved work visa from your home country or through a sponsoring Japanese employer.

    The basic requirements include a valid passport, completed visa application form, recent passport-size photo, proof of travel plans, financial means, and, in some cases, a letter of employment or residency.
